  • Source and Nationality Requirements

The Applicant must ensure that the procurement did not originate in the USAID prohibited source countries. ADS 310 - https://www.usaid.gov/ads/policy/300/310 - states the following: No services may be procured from suppliers with a nationality from countries designated by USAID as “prohibited sources.” Additionally, no goods may be procured from source countries that are designated as prohibited sources. The list of countries designated as prohibited sourcescan be found here - https://www.usaid.gov/ads/policy/300/310mac under List of Prohibited Source Countries and here https://home.treasury.gov/policy-issues/financial-sanctions/sanctions-programs-and-country-information.

If IREX determines that the Applicant has procured any commodities or services under the award related to this RfP contrary to the requirements of this provision, and has received payment for such purposes, IREX may require the Applicant to refund the entire amount of the purchase.

The desired source and nationality of procurement would be EU countries, Turkey, USA, etc. Please check the link above to see the list of prohibited source countries prior to submitting the offer, as source countries may be on USAID’s barred countries and will not be considered.
